Can You Get Trichinosis From Eating Raw or Undercooked Bacon?
Eating raw or undercooked pork products like bacon can expose you to the risk of trichinosis, a foodborne illness caused by roundworm parasites. However, the prevalence of this disease has declined dramatically over the past few decades thanks to changes in pig farming and pork processing.
